DTC U0047-00 (VSA Control Unit (Without CAN Gateway)) (2017 2018 2019)

DTC U0047-00  : CAN Communication Failure (Bus OFF Ch 2)

NOTE: Before you troubleshoot, review the general troubleshooting information .

DTC Description DTC Freeze Frame
U0047-00 CAN Communication Failure (Bus OFF Ch 2)    

DTC (VSA)

  1. Problem verification

    -1. Turn the vehicle to the ON mode.

    -2. Clear the DTC with the HDS.

    -3. Turn the vehicle to the OFF (LOCK) mode, then start the engine.

    -4. Check for DTCs with the HDS.

    DTC Description DTC Freeze Frame
    U0047-00 CAN Communication Failure (Bus OFF Ch 2)    

    Is DTC U0047-00 indicated?

    YES 

    The failure is duplicated. Go to step 2.

    NO 

    Intermittent failure, the system is OK at this time. Refer to intermittent failures troubleshooting . If the freeze data/on-board snapshot of this DTC is recorded, try to reproduce the failure under the same conditions with the freeze data/on-board snapshot.

  2. EBB CAN circuit resistance check

    -1. Turn the vehicle to the OFF (LOCK) mode with driver's door open.

    -2. Wait for 3 minutes.

    NOTE:  Do not close the driver's door.

    -3. Disconnect the following connector.

    VSA modulator-control unit 46P connector

    -4. Measure the resistance between test points 1 and 2.

    Test condition Vehicle OFF (LOCK) mode
      VSA modulator-control unit 46P connector: disconnected
    Test point 1 VSA modulator-control unit 46P connector No. 46
    Test point 2 VSA modulator-control unit 46P connector No. 34

    Is there about 108-132 Ω ?

    YES 

    Go to step 5.

    NO 

    Go to step 3.

  3. Shorted wire check (EBB CAN H line to EBB CAN L line)

    -1. Disconnect the following connector.

    Electric brake booster 26P connector

    -2. Check for continuity between test points 1 and 2.

    Test condition Vehicle OFF (LOCK) mode
    VSA modulator-control unit 46P connector: disconnected
    Electric brake booster 26P connector: disconnected
    Test point 1 VSA modulator-control unit 46P connector No. 46
    Test point 2 VSA modulator-control unit 46P connector No. 34

    Is there continuity?

    YES 

    Repair a short in the wires between the VSA modulator-control unit terminals 46 and 34.

    NO 

    Go to step 4.

  4. Open wire check (EBB CAN H, EBB CAN L lines)

    -1. Check for continuity between test points 1 and 2.

    Test condition Vehicle OFF (LOCK) mode
      VSA modulator-control unit 46P connector: disconnected
      Electric brake booster 26P connector: disconnected
    Test circuit 1  
    Test point 1 VSA modulator-control unit 46P connector No. 46
    Test point 2 Electric brake booster 26P connector No. 19
    Test circuit 2  
    Test point 1 VSA modulator-control unit 46P connector No. 34
    Test point 2 Electric brake booster 26P connector No. 12

    Is there continuity?

    YES 

    The EBB CAN H, EBB CAN L wires are OK. Check for loose terminals and poor connections in the electric brake booster 26P connector. If they are OK, replace the electric brake booster .

    NO 

    Repair an open in the wire between the VSA modulator-control unit and the electric brake booster.

  5. Shorted wire check (EBB CAN H, EBB CAN L lines)

    -1. Disconnect the following connector.

    Electric brake booster 26P connector

    -2. Check for continuity between test points 1 and 2.

    Test condition Vehicle OFF (LOCK) mode
      VSA modulator-control unit 46P connector: disconnected
      Electric brake booster 26P connector: disconnected
    Test circuit 1  
    Test point 1 VSA modulator-control unit 46P connector No. 46
    Test point 2 Body ground
    Test circuit 2  
    Test point 1 VSA modulator-control unit 46P connector No. 34
    Test point 2 Body ground

    Is there continuity?

    YES 

    Repair a short to ground in the wire between the VSA modulator-control unit and the electric brake booster.

    NO 

    The EBB CAN H, EBB CAN L wires are OK. Check for loose terminals and poor connections in the VSA modulator-control unit 46P connector. Check for any authorized service information related to the DTCs or symptoms you are troubleshooting. If they are OK, replace the VSA modulator-control unit .
